Maintenance Supervisor
4 months ago
Maintenance Supervisor NP11 - Crosskeys area £35k - £45k (dep exp) The Company Our client is an innovator in the environmental sector who have an opportunity to join them as their Maintenance Supervisor for a state of the art waste recycling facility. This provides the opportunity to be part of a secure and long term maintenance role. The Role of a Maintenance Supervisor
- Reporting to the Group Maintenance Manager this role is a standalone position l responsible for the mechanical maintenance of the Environmental Processing Plant.
- As our Maintenance Supervisor you will ensure that any mechanical problems are rectified as a priority and planned preventative maintenance measures are in place and carried out accordingly.
- As our Maintenance Supervisor you will carry out any fault finding and repair of all associated plant and machinery, such as conveyors, hydraulics, etc
- As Maintenance Supervisor you will co-ordinate and check contractors work.
- The successful candidate will have a mechanical maintenance background, experience working with heavy machinery, manufacturing, waste management or agriculture.
- You may currently be fitter/engineer looking for your next step into a supervisory role.
- The Successful Maintenance Technician will have good communication skills and the ability to work positively in a team environment.
- Strong health and safety knowledge.
- The ideal candidate will have a positive, cheery and can do personality and attitude.
- This role would suit an individual who is keen to develop themselves as our business also grows
